    Adjunct Instructor (On Ground and Remote Learning) Reputation Management builds on the foundational content of audience, ethical communication, and decoding and encoding of information. Understanding how a reputation is built, maintained, enhanced, and/or destroyed is rooted in a healthy understanding of theoretical and practical knowledge of related theories. The course will expose students to the tenets of the following theories: social relationships, relationship rules, social learning, and transformative relationships. The class structure works on the student\'s reputation and repair while understanding the importance of overall reputation in a globalized world. Fundamentals of Info Technology provides the student with an understanding of computers and the impact of information technology on organizations and society. The complexity of designing effective information systems is discussed, and the student learns to compare, analyze, and evaluate information. Students will examine social, legal, and ethical issues involving privacy, intellectual property, health concerns, and accessibility. Intercultural Communication focuses on building relationships with diverse groups of people. Attention is given to multicultural and ethical awareness, leadership styles, small group processes, and problem-solving methods. We examine personal and societal biases and their role in everyday life. Public Speaking and Persuasion assists students in refining research and writing skills, argument research and persuasion, and developing appropriate computer-assisted presentational materials to enhance the delivery of speeches. Professional Communication in the Workplace works with students to explore the importance and practice of adapting communications in a globalized business world. Teach students how to utilize MS Word, Excel, and PowerPoint as communication tools.
